Ccs报错代表什么?快速解决方法有哪些?
在前端开发的过程中,CSS预处理器如Sass或Less使用广泛,而作为CSS预处理器语言的CascadingStyleSheets(CSS)本身也可能会出现错误,这通常会通过浏览器的开发者工具展现为CSS报错信息。这一类问题会直接影响网站的展示效果,因此及时识别和解决这些报错至关重要。本文将会带你了解常见的CSS错误信息,以及如何快速解决这些问题。
什么是CSS报错?
CSS报错指的是浏览器在解析CSS代码时遇到了它无法理解或无法处理的代码段,进而生成的错误提示。这些错误可能是语法错误、忘记闭合标签、无效的属性值等,它们会导致特定的CSS规则失效,从而影响网站的视觉呈现。
如何识别常见的CSS报错?
当浏览器遇到CSS错误时,通常会在开发者工具(DevTools)的控制台(Console)中显示错误信息。通过查看这些信息,你可以知道错误发生在哪一行,以及可能出现错误的代码片段。识别错误类型是快速修复它们的第一步。
核心关键词优化示例:
CSS报错信息通常包含一个错误类型,比如:
`SyntaxError`
`ReferenceError`
`TypeError`
快速解决CSS报错的策略
下面,我们将逐一看一些快速定位和解决CSS报错的方法。
1.语法错误
解决方法
核对报错信息中指定的行号,检查是否有遗漏的括号、花括号、分号等。
确认属性和值之间是否有空格,确保在冒号后留有空格。
2.选择器不生效
解决方法
检查选择器是否有拼写错误,以及是否有相应的HTML元素匹配。
确认选择器是否有足够的特异性覆盖其他CSS规则。
3.主要颜色代码错误
解决方法
核实颜色关键字、十六进制、RGB、RGBA、HSL和HSLA等颜色值的写法是否正确。
4.文件路径错误
解决方法
检查CSS文件中引用的图片、字体等资源路径是否正确,并确保路径相对于CSS文件是相对路径还是绝对路径。
5.CSS文件未加载
解决方法
确保CSS链接标签`
长尾关键词优化示例:
CSS报错`SyntaxError:Unexpectedtoken`
CSS报错`ReferenceError:cssPropertyisnotdefined`
CSS报错`TypeError:Cannotreadproperty`
提高用户体验的技巧
使用`@support`和条件注释来提供不同浏览器的特定样式,确保网站兼容性。
在编写CSS时,多使用变量和混合来规范化代码,防止因重复代码带来的错误。
总体考虑
CSS报错的解决并不是一件非常困难的事,关键在于准确识别错误原因并采取正确的策略。在日常开发的过程中,经常使用浏览器开发者工具来检查页面的CSS代码,这样可以在问题变成大问题之前将其解决。通过实践这些技巧,你可以更快地定位到问题所在,并且保持网站的美观和用户界面的一致性。
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 3561739510@qq.com 举报,一经查实,本站将立刻删除。
- 站长推荐
-
-
Win10一键永久激活工具推荐(简单实用的工具助您永久激活Win10系统)
-
手机打开U盘的软件推荐(方便快捷的U盘访问工具)
-
解决豆浆机底部漏水问题的方法(保护豆浆机)
-
随身WiFi亮红灯无法上网解决方法(教你轻松解决随身WiFi亮红灯无法连接网络问题)
-
2024年核显最强CPU排名揭晓(逐鹿高峰)
-
光芒燃气灶怎么维修?教你轻松解决常见问题
-
iphone解锁就黑屏转圈重启无效(iphone解锁屏幕显示恢复方法)
-
开机显示器变红的原因及解决方法(探究开机后显示器出现红色屏幕的原因)
-
联想vs.戴尔(耐用性能对比分析及用户体验评价)
-
联想bios设置启动顺序正确(按照操作步骤轻松设置联想BIOS启动顺序)
-
- 热门tag
- 标签列表
- 友情链接